π― What Is Copywriting (For Designers)?
Copywriting is not writing long articles, poetry, or captions.
Copywriting is the skill of writing words that influence action, such as:
β Buying
β Clicking
β Signing up
β Sharing
β Trusting
Design grabs attention.
Copywriting turns that attention into results.
Design + Copy = the most powerful combination in marketing.

π§ What Kind of Copywriting Should Designers Learn?
You donβt need to learn long-form copywriting.
Focus on conversion-focused microcopy, such as:
Headlines & hooks
Ad copy
Website hero text
CTAs
Marketing concepts
Taglines / slogans
Social media captions
Branding tone of voice
UX/UI microcopy
This is the kind of copy that makes design work.
π How to Start Learning Copywriting as a Designer
Step 1: Study psychology & persuasion
β AIDA framework
β Storytelling structure
β Buyer behavior
Step 2: Practice writing headlines & hooks
Rewrite ads, landing pages, or your own posts.
Step 3: Reverse-engineer high-converting designs
Ask: Why does THIS work?
Step 4: Combine copy with your design process
Start planning message hierarchy BEFORE layout.
Step 5: Build copywriting into your service
Offer:
β Design + Copy
β Strategy + Execution
β Branded messaging
